如何添加主键语句MySQL
引言
在MySQL数据库中,主键是用来唯一标识表中每一行数据的字段或字段组合。它具有唯一性和非空性的特点,可以在查询、更新和删除等操作中提高效率。在本篇文章中,我将向你介绍如何在MySQL中添加主键语句,并给出相应的代码示例。
添加主键的流程
首先,让我们来看一下添加主键的整个流程,如下所示:
步骤 | 操作 |
---|---|
1 | 进入MySQL命令行 |
2 | 选择要添加主键的数据库 |
3 | 选择要添加主键的表 |
4 | 添加主键 |
5 | 验证主键是否添加成功 |
接下来,我将分步骤向你解释每一步需要做什么,并提供相应的代码示例。
步骤1:进入MySQL命令行
首先,你需要打开终端并输入以下命令,进入MySQL命令行:
mysql -u 用户名 -p
其中,用户名
是你的MySQL用户名。你将被要求输入密码才能进入MySQL命令行。
步骤2:选择要添加主键的数据库
一旦你进入MySQL命令行,你需要选择要添加主键的数据库。使用以下命令:
USE 数据库名;
其中,数据库名
是你要操作的数据库的名称。
步骤3:选择要添加主键的表
接下来,你需要选择要添加主键的表。使用以下命令:
ALTER TABLE 表名;
其中,表名
是你要操作的表的名称。
步骤4:添加主键
现在,我们将开始添加主键。主键可以选择一个或多个字段,取决于你的需求。以下是添加单个字段主键和添加多个字段主键的示例。
添加单个字段主键
使用以下命令添加单个字段主键:
ALTER TABLE 表名
ADD PRIMARY KEY (字段名);
其中,表名
是你要操作的表的名称,字段名
是你要作为主键的字段的名称。
添加多个字段主键
使用以下命令添加多个字段主键:
ALTER TABLE 表名
ADD PRIMARY KEY (字段1, 字段2, ...);
其中,表名
是你要操作的表的名称,字段1, 字段2, ...
是你要作为主键的多个字段的名称。
步骤5:验证主键是否添加成功
最后,我们需要验证主键是否成功添加到表中。使用以下命令可以查看表结构:
DESCRIBE 表名;
其中,表名
是你要操作的表的名称。
在表结构中,你应该能够看到一个新的列标记为“PRI”,表示该列是主键。如果你看到这个标记,那么主键已经成功添加到表中。
总结
通过以上步骤,你现在应该知道如何在MySQL中添加主键语句了。以下是添加主键的流程图:
pie
title 添加主键的流程
"进入MySQL命令行" : 1
"选择要添加主键的数据库" : 2
"选择要添加主键的表" : 3
"添加主键" : 4
"验证主键是否添加成功" : 5
希望本文对你有所帮助!